llvm.org GIT mirror llvm / b10946a
A few 80-col violations. git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@141988 91177308-0d34-0410-b5e6-96231b3b80d8 Evan Cheng 9 years ago
2 changed file(s) with 10 addition(s) and 5 deletion(s). Raw diff Collapse all Expand all
5454
5555 STATISTIC(NumVirtualFrameRegs, "Number of virtual frame regs encountered");
5656 STATISTIC(NumScavengedRegs, "Number of frame index regs scavenged");
57 STATISTIC(NumBytesStackSpace, "Number of bytes used for stack in all functions");
57 STATISTIC(NumBytesStackSpace,
58 "Number of bytes used for stack in all functions");
5859
5960 /// createPrologEpilogCodeInserter - This function returns a pass that inserts
6061 /// prolog and epilog code, and eliminates abstract frame references.
3333 Reloc::Model RM, CodeModel::Model CM)
3434 : X86TargetMachine(T, TT, CPU, FS, RM, CM, false),
3535 DataLayout(getSubtargetImpl()->isTargetDarwin() ?
36 "e-p:32:32-f64:32:64-i64:32:64-f80:128:128-f128:128:128-n8:16:32-S128" :
36 "e-p:32:32-f64:32:64-i64:32:64-f80:128:128-f128:128:128-"
37 "n8:16:32-S128" :
3738 (getSubtargetImpl()->isTargetCygMing() ||
3839 getSubtargetImpl()->isTargetWindows()) ?
39 "e-p:32:32-f64:64:64-i64:64:64-f80:32:32-f128:128:128-n8:16:32-S32" :
40 "e-p:32:32-f64:32:64-i64:32:64-f80:32:32-f128:128:128-n8:16:32-S128"),
40 "e-p:32:32-f64:64:64-i64:64:64-f80:32:32-f128:128:128-"
41 "n8:16:32-S32" :
42 "e-p:32:32-f64:32:64-i64:32:64-f80:32:32-f128:128:128-"
43 "n8:16:32-S128"),
4144 InstrInfo(*this),
4245 TSInfo(*this),
4346 TLInfo(*this),
4952 StringRef CPU, StringRef FS,
5053 Reloc::Model RM, CodeModel::Model CM)
5154 : X86TargetMachine(T, TT, CPU, FS, RM, CM, true),
52 DataLayout("e-p:64:64-s:64-f64:64:64-i64:64:64-f80:128:128-f128:128:128-n8:16:32:64-S128"),
55 DataLayout("e-p:64:64-s:64-f64:64:64-i64:64:64-f80:128:128-f128:128:128-"
56 "n8:16:32:64-S128"),
5357 InstrInfo(*this),
5458 TSInfo(*this),
5559 TLInfo(*this),